How to calculate number of bricks with cement mortar

In this construction video, you can learn how to work out the number of bricks that contain cement mortar for specified volume.

The calculation is made on the basis of the following dimension :-

The size of brick exclusive of cement mortar is taken as 190 x 90 x 90 mm
The density of cement mortar is taken as 10 mm
Proportion of cement mortar is given as 1:6
The volume of brickwork is taken as 1M3
The calculation will be as follow :-
Volume of 1 brick exclusive of cement mortar = 0.19 x 0.09 x 0.09 = 0.001539 M3 (after converting the value to meter)

Volume of 1 brick including cement mortar = 0.2 x 0.1 x 0.1 = 0.002 M3 (after adding density of mortar with brick)
Number of bricks having cement mortar in 1M3 = 1/0.002 = 500 nos. (volume of brickwork = 1 and volume of 1 brick with cement mortar = 0.002 M3)
